  1. Dec 14, 2022 · Symptoms of pseudomembranous colitis may include: Watery diarrhea. Stomach cramps, pain or tenderness. Fever. Pus or mucus in the stool. Nausea. Dehydration. Symptoms of pseudomembranous colitis can begin as soon as 1 to 2 days after you start taking an antibiotic, or as long as several months or longer after you finish taking the antibiotic.

  7. Jun 15, 2024 · In pseudomembranous colitis, the lining of the colon becomes inflamed and forms a yellow-white membrane called a pseudomembrane. Most often, pseudomembranous colitis occurs due to infection by a bacteria called Clostridioides difficile ( C. difficile, or C. diff ) .

  8. Symptoms include: Abdominal cramps (mild to severe) Bloody stools. Fever. Urge to have a bowel movement. Watery diarrhea (often 5 to 10 times per day) Exams and Tests. The following tests may be done: Colonoscopy or flexible sigmoidoscopy. Immunoassay for C difficile toxin in the stool.
